0

下午好,

我想知道是否有人可以填写我。是否有可能找到一个数组对象的索引,它是文档中的一个数组?使用下面的文档,我想知道用户 ID 为 15 的项目内对象的索引(在本例中索引为 1)。

这可能吗?如果可以,我将如何去做这个 find()?

    {
      "_id" : ObjectId("4fb6c4791e1a121434000000"),
      "set" : "2",
      "items" : [{
                  "image" : "",
                  "userid" : 14
       }, {
                  "image" : "",
                  "userid" : 15
       }]
    }

谢谢你的帮助。

4

1 回答 1

0

我不知道有任何方法可以让您直接执行此操作。我不知道您的架构的其余部分,或者本文档真正包含的内容,因此几乎不可能提出替代方案。(如果你更新问题,我会更新我的答案)

于 2012-05-21T08:38:42.837 回答